I completely agree with you. Data storage is indeed crucial for a casino complaint system for a variety of reasons. Here are some key points:

1. **Track and Store Complaints:** Data storage enables the system to keep a detailed record of all complaints received from customers. This information can include the nature of the complaint, the time it was lodged, and any interactions or resolutions that took place. Having this data stored securely ensures that nothing gets lost or overlooked.

2. **Identify Patterns and Trends:** By analyzing the stored data over time, the casino can identify common issues or trends in complaints. This can help them pinpoint underlying problems in their operations, services, or policies that are causing customer dissatisfaction. With this insight, the casino can take proactive measures to address these issues and improve customer satisfaction.

3. **Personalized Customer Experience:** Data storage allows the casino to gather information about individual customers, such as their preferences, playing habits, and history of complaints. By having this data readily available, the casino can offer a more personalized experience to customers. For example, they can tailor promotions, offers, or services based on the customer's past interactions with the casino.

4. **Efficient Resolution of Complaints:** Storing complaint data in a structured manner enables the casino staff to access relevant information quickly when addressing customer complaints. This can lead to more efficient and effective resolutions, as staff members have all the necessary details at their fingertips.

5. **Legal and Regulatory Compliance:** Proper data storage practices are essential for casinos to comply with legal and regulatory requirements related to customer complaints. By securely storing complaint data, casinos can demonstrate transparency, accountability, and adherence to privacy laws.

In summary, data storage plays a critical role in shaping the effectiveness and efficiency of a casino complaint system. It not only helps in resolving individual complaints but also contributes to improving overall customer satisfaction and operational performance.
 
Data storage plays a crucial role in the effectiveness of a casino's complaint system. By securely storing relevant information such as player accounts, transaction histories, gameplay records, and communication logs, casinos can accurately investigate and resolve complaints. Access to comprehensive data allows casino staff to verify the legitimacy of claims, track patterns of behavior, and identify any discrepancies or irregularities. Furthermore, stored data can serve as evidence in dispute resolution processes, helping to ensure fair outcomes for all parties involved. Overall, robust data storage capabilities are essential for maintaining transparency, accountability, and customer satisfaction in a casino's complaint handling procedures.
